Authorities believe a 13-year-old Wisconsin boy missing since Monday is alive and tring to live “off the grid.” Sauk County Sheriff’s Office Lt. Steven Schram told the Wisconsin State Journal that investigators have developed a profile of James Yoblonski “which leads us to believe he is acting with intention.” The teen drove away from his …
